构建基于云计算的AI语音识别系统教程

随着科技的飞速发展,人工智能(AI)技术已经渗透到我们生活的方方面面。其中,AI语音识别技术在语音助手、智能客服、智能家居等领域发挥着越来越重要的作用。云计算作为新一代的信息技术,为AI语音识别系统的构建提供了强大的支持。本文将为您讲述一个基于云计算的AI语音识别系统构建的故事。

一、故事背景

张明,一名年轻的AI技术爱好者,从小就对人工智能充满好奇。在大学期间,他主修计算机科学与技术专业,并积极参与各种AI项目。毕业后,张明进入了一家互联网公司,负责AI语音识别系统的研发。在工作中,他发现传统的语音识别系统存在一些问题,如计算资源消耗大、系统扩展性差等。于是,他萌生了构建一个基于云计算的AI语音识别系统的想法。

二、故事发展

  1. 确定系统架构

张明首先对现有的AI语音识别系统进行了深入研究,分析其优缺点。结合云计算技术,他提出了一个全新的系统架构:分布式语音识别系统。该系统由云端服务器、边缘服务器和终端设备组成,实现了语音数据采集、处理和识别的分布式处理。


  1. 选择云计算平台

为了实现分布式语音识别系统,张明选择了国内领先的云计算平台——阿里云。阿里云提供了丰富的云计算资源,包括弹性计算、大数据处理、机器学习等,为AI语音识别系统的构建提供了强有力的支持。


  1. 设计系统功能模块

基于云计算平台,张明将AI语音识别系统分为以下几个功能模块:

(1)语音采集模块:负责从终端设备采集语音数据,并将其传输到云端服务器。

(2)语音预处理模块:对采集到的语音数据进行降噪、增强等处理,提高语音质量。

(3)语音特征提取模块:从预处理后的语音数据中提取特征,如MFCC(梅尔频率倒谱系数)、PLP(感知线性预测)等。

(4)语音识别模块:基于深度学习算法,对提取的特征进行识别,输出识别结果。

(5)结果展示模块:将识别结果展示给用户,如文字、语音等形式。


  1. 系统开发与测试

在完成系统架构和功能模块设计后,张明开始进行系统开发。他采用Python编程语言,利用TensorFlow、Keras等深度学习框架,实现了语音识别模块。同时,他还利用阿里云提供的API,实现了语音采集、预处理和展示等功能。

在开发过程中,张明不断进行系统测试,优化系统性能。经过多次迭代,他终于将一个功能完善的AI语音识别系统搭建完成。


  1. 系统应用与推广

随着AI语音识别系统的完善,张明开始将其应用于实际场景。他成功将该系统应用于智能家居、智能客服等领域,取得了良好的效果。同时,他还积极参与开源社区,将系统代码分享给广大开发者,推动AI语音识别技术的发展。

三、故事结局

经过不断努力,张明的基于云计算的AI语音识别系统得到了广泛认可。他的故事也成为了AI技术爱好者的榜样。如今,张明已经成为了一名优秀的AI技术专家,继续在人工智能领域探索创新。

在这个故事中,我们看到了云计算和AI技术的结合,为语音识别领域带来了新的发展机遇。相信在不久的将来,随着技术的不断进步,基于云计算的AI语音识别系统将会在更多领域发挥重要作用,为我们的生活带来更多便利。

猜你喜欢:AI机器人